Output 2390bdf6f7d627a17d81c8d29cbb41f0eb84c0f9b820b9a90afb56ab7cb7f532:2

value
11544961
script pubkey
OP_0 OP_PUSHBYTES_20 344cc7df1d466e3058a62076f009629b8141023a
address
bc1qx3xv0hcagehrqk9xypm0qztznwq5zq363e7h6n
transaction
2390bdf6f7d627a17d81c8d29cbb41f0eb84c0f9b820b9a90afb56ab7cb7f532
spent
true